This isn't Unreal Engine, and the developer got it's start strictly as a PC developer, and a good one at that, IMO.

sabin1981 wrote:
It was the UE2 for the PS2/Xbox ports, Diesel for the PC one and something called "Yeti" for the X360 .. lol.

Guess they had a FEW engines Very Happy

GRIN didn't do any versions of GRAW/2 other than the PC versions. They had nothing to do with the console versions. GRIN only works with with their own in-house Diesel engine.

The March 2009 issue of GamePro is a world exclusive first look at Terminator Salvation the game. Feast your eyes on the cover below and get a look at Terminator 4's new evil-looking T-600 model!

The March issue of GamePro magazine is about to blow your face off like the enormous Earth-incinerating blast depicted in Terminator 2: Judgment Day. The multi-page Terminator Salvation cover story is bursting with exclusive information about the ambitious Terminator Salvation video game, which is a prequel to the upcoming fourth Terminator movie staring Christian Bale (The Dark Knight, Batman Begins). The game is coming to Xbox 360, PS3, Wii, and PC.

In GamePro's Terminator Salvation story you'll get an inside look at both the upcoming video game and the new Terminator film, including:

Terminator Salvation's numerous menacing Terminator machines, including one that makes Arnie's model look friendly

First details on Terminator Salvation's epic story

The weapons used in Salvation's battle against the machines

A guide to all the versions of the humanoid Terminator models, everything from Schwarzenegger's T-800 up till now.

Images from both the movie and the game

A look back at previous Terminator video games
And more!
